What is the Employment Application Form?
The Employment Application Form is a critical document utilized during the hiring process, allowing job applicants to present essential information to potential employers. This form collects personal data, work experience, education credentials, and references. In addition to these details, applicants must acknowledge aspects such as any criminal records and adherence to drug policies, thus providing a comprehensive view of their background.

What are the eligibility requirements for filling out the Employment Application Form?
Applicants must generally be at least 18 years old and eligible to work in the U.S. Ensure you have the necessary personal and professional information ready before starting the application.
Is there a deadline for submitting the Employment Application Form?
Deadlines for submitting the Employment Application Form vary by employer. It's essential to check with the specific job listing or company for any application timelines.
How do I submit the completed Employment Application Form?
After filling out the Employment Application Form, submit it as directed by the employer. This could involve uploading it to a job portal, emailing it, or presenting it in person.
What supporting documents are required with the Employment Application Form?
Typically, applicants may need to provide a resume and references. Some employers may also request documents verifying work eligibility.
What are common mistakes to avoid when completing the Employment Application Form?
Common mistakes include providing inaccurate information, neglecting to complete all required fields, and failing to review the form for typos or errors before submission.
What is the processing time for the Employment Application Form?
Processing times vary depending on the employer's review procedures. Applicants may expect to hear back within a week or two after submission, but this can differ based on the company.
Are there fees associated with submitting the Employment Application Form?
Generally, there are no fees to submit employment applications. However, check with the employer for any specific requirements or associated costs.
